Adobe Target Cookie

Adobe Target 使用 Cookie 讓網站操作人員能夠測試哪些線上內容和方案與訪客的關聯性較強。

NOTE
本文中的資訊僅適用於Adobe Target JavaScript資料庫 (at.js)。 請參閱Adobe Experience Platform Web SDK Cookie,瞭解使用Web SDK的Target實作資訊。
如有需要,您可以變更本文中討論的設定,但Cookie持續時間除外。 變更Cookie設定時,請洽詢您的帳戶代表

第一方Cookie

下列第一方Cookie會儲存在客戶的網域上:

Cookie
詳細資料
mbox

儲存訪客的匿名識別碼。

Cookie網域:您提供mbox的網域。 因為此Cookie來自您公司的網域,所以此Cookie是第一方Cookie。 如果您的網域名稱包含國碼(例如example.co.uk),請和客戶服務代表合作設定at.js以支援此代碼。 如需有關自訂Cookie網域的資訊,如有必要,請參閱Adobe Target開發人員指南中targetGlobalSettings底下的cookieDomain

伺服器網域clientcode.tt.omtrdc.net,使用您Adobe Target帳戶的使用者端代碼。

Cookie持續時間:自上次登入起,Cookie會保留在訪客的瀏覽器上兩年。 Cookie 持續時間無法變更。

Cookie會保留一些值,用於管理訪客體驗Target活動的方式:

工作階段識別碼:特定使用者工作階段的唯一識別碼。 根據預設,工作階段會在閒置 30 分鐘後過期。 如果您要自行產生sessionId (例如,針對伺服器端實作),請確定下列事項:

  • 工作階段ID可以是任何可列印的字串,除了空格、問號( ? ) 或正斜線 ( / ) 以外。
  • 工作階段ID的長度應該介於1到128個字元之間。
  • 針對特定工作階段,Cookie的值在多個要求中必須維持不變。
  • 特定訪客在任何時間點絕對不應該有平行工作階段(不同的sessionIds)。

路由傳送到邊緣叢集內的特定節點是使用工作階段ID完成的。

  • 工作階段在伺服器端會維持 30 分鐘的有效狀態。 因此,您不應在與tntId/thirdPartyId發出上次要求後的30分鐘內,針對特定tntId/thirdPartyId使用不同的工作階段ID。 否則,基本資料的變更可能會不一致且無法預測。
  • 訪客閒置30分鐘後,必須使用該新的工作階段ID。
  • 搭配多個tntIds/thirdPartyIds使用相同工作階段ID可能會對tntId/thirdPartyIDs所識別的基本資料造成無法預測的變更。

注意:請參閱指定工作階段ID的並行要求數目限制

電腦ID:訪客瀏覽器的半永久ID。 持續到手動刪除 Cookie 為止。

check:用來判斷訪客是否支援Cookie的簡單測試值。 每次訪客請求頁面時都會進行設定。

停用:如果訪客的載入時間超過at.js檔案中所設定的逾時時間,則設定此選項。 根據預設,此逾時會持續一小時。

at_check
臨時Cookie ,用於檢查瀏覽器上是否已啟用Cookie讀取/寫入功能。
mboxEdgeCluster
只有當overrideMboxEdgeServer設定設為true時,此Cookie才會出現。

無法在這些第一方Cookie上使用HTTPOnlyat.js JavaScript程式庫需要讀取/寫入這些Cookie。 這些Cookie是由at.js建立的,而且不是從伺服器設定的。

可以使用at.js中的secureOnly: true設定,在所有這些Cookie上啟用secure設定。

第三方Cookie

Adobe Target使用者可建立自訂的第三方Cookie。 下列第三方Cookie儲存在tt.omtrdc.net上:

Cookie
詳細資料
customerclientcode!mboxPC
在啟用跨網域時顯示。
customerclientcode!mboxSession
在啟用跨網域時顯示。

這些協力廠商Cookie是HTTPnly開箱即用,並由Adobe Target資料收集伺服器設定。

可以使用at.js中的secureOnly: true設定,在所有Cookie上啟用secure設定。

recommendation-more-help
872fc4ed-f5f7-4b59-a6f8-4ddabe5aac1f